plc编程16进制什么意思
-
PLC编程中的16进制表示的是一种数字系统,它使用16个不同的符号来表示数字,包括0-9和A-F。在PLC编程中,使用16进制可以方便地表示和处理二进制数据。
在16进制系统中,每个数字的值分别为0、1、2、3、4、5、6、7、8、9、A、B、C、D、E、F。其中,A表示10,B表示11,以此类推,F表示15。
在PLC编程中,16进制常用于表示地址、寄存器值、数据位等。对于地址和寄存器值,使用16进制可以更加直观地表示和识别。例如,一个输入地址可能表示为0x10,一个输出地址可能表示为0x20。对于数据位,使用16进制可以更加方便地表示二进制数。例如,一个数据位的值为0xFF,表示该位全为1。
在PLC编程中,使用16进制需要注意一些细节。首先,16进制数需要以0x开头,以区分于十进制数。其次,16进制数的每个位都可以取0-15的值,超过15的值需要使用两位来表示。例如,16进制数0x10表示十进制数16,而0x1A表示十进制数26。
总而言之,16进制在PLC编程中用来表示和处理二进制数据,它提供了一种直观和方便的方式来表示和操作数字。
1年前 -
PLC编程中的16进制是一种数字表示方法,其中使用了16个不同的符号来表示数字。每个符号表示4个二进制位,因此可以表示更大的范围。16进制在PLC编程中常用于表示内存地址、数据值和指令。
以下是PLC编程中16进制的几个重要含义:
-
内存地址:PLC中的内存被分为多个地址,用于存储变量、输入输出值和指令。这些地址通常使用16进制表示。例如,0x1000表示内存地址为1000的位置。
-
数据值:PLC编程中的数据值可以使用16进制表示。这在处理二进制数据时特别有用。例如,0xFF表示十进制的255,而0x10表示十进制的16。
-
指令:PLC编程中的指令通常使用16进制表示。这些指令控制PLC的操作,如数据传输、逻辑运算和比较。每个指令都有一个特定的16进制编码。例如,0x02表示数据传输指令,0x0A表示逻辑与操作。
-
编程标记:在PLC编程中,使用16进制编码来标记和识别不同的程序块、变量和指令。这些编码通常以16进制表示,以便更容易识别和区分。例如,0x100表示程序块1,0x200表示程序块2。
-
位操作:PLC编程中的位操作通常使用16进制编码。位操作用于设置、清除和检测特定的位。例如,0x08表示二进制的0000 1000,可以用于设置或清除某个位。
总之,PLC编程中的16进制是一种常用的数字表示方法,用于表示内存地址、数据值、指令和编程标记。熟练掌握16进制编码对于PLC编程非常重要。
1年前 -
-
PLC编程中的16进制是一种表示数值的方法,其中使用16个数字和字母(0-9,A-F)来表示数值。与常见的十进制数(0-9)不同,16进制数使用更多的字符来表示数字,这在某些情况下会更加方便。
在PLC编程中,16进制常用于表示内存地址、寄存器值、位操作等。下面将详细介绍PLC编程中16进制的使用方法和操作流程。
-
16进制数的表示方法:
在PLC编程中,16进制数通常以0x开头,后面跟随具体的16进制数值。例如,0x10表示十进制的16,0xFF表示十进制的255。 -
内存地址表示:
PLC中的内存地址通常使用16进制表示。例如,0x0000表示第一个内存地址,0x0001表示第二个内存地址,依此类推。 -
寄存器值表示:
PLC中的寄存器值可以使用16进制表示。例如,如果一个寄存器的值为10,可以用0x0A来表示。 -
位操作:
在PLC编程中,位操作是非常常见的。在16进制中,每个位都可以用一个二进制数表示,其中每个位对应一个十六进制数(0-F)。例如,0x0F表示二进制的0000 1111,其中每个位表示一个开关状态。 -
16进制与其他进制的转换:
在PLC编程中,经常需要在不同进制之间进行转换。可以使用PLC编程软件提供的函数或指令来实现进制转换。- 十进制转16进制:可以使用十进制数的除法和取余操作将十进制数转换为16进制数。例如,将十进制的16转换为16进制,可以使用除法16,余数为0,然后逆序排列余数得到0x10。
- 16进制转十进制:可以使用16进制数的乘法和加法将16进制数转换为十进制数。例如,将16进制的0x10转换为十进制,可以计算1*16+0=16。
总结:
在PLC编程中,16进制是一种常用的数值表示方法,用于表示内存地址、寄存器值和进行位操作。掌握16进制的使用方法和转换技巧对于PLC编程非常重要。1年前 -